Bitcoin briefly tops $79,500 as spot BTC ETF inflows accelerate
Spot bitcoin ETFs brought in $606 million on Aug. 20, while ether funds added $221 million, both above the prior day.
Bitcoin surged more than 6% in the past 24 hours, briefly topping $79,500 before easing back below $78,000, according to CoinDesk’s live market updates.
CoinDesk reported that the rally also lifted crypto-linked equities, with Strategy (MSTR) up 10%, Coinbase up 6%, and MARA Holdings gaining 6%, while Galaxy Digital rose 5%.
The broader move was reinforced by ETF activity, with spot bitcoin ETFs pulling in $606 million on Aug. 20, and ether funds recording $221 million, both described as higher than the prior day.
CoinDesk also noted analysts characterizing recent price action as the kind of pattern that can mark market turning points, adding that the ETF flows and follow through are key factors to watch going into the next week.
